Emirates will commence flights to Luanda (LAD) in Angola effective 2 August 2009.

Flights will be operated 3x weekly (Tue, Thu, Sun) using A330-200 aircraft in a 3-class configuration. Flights depart mid morning from Dubai and return early in the morning (0600 bank) the following day. Will post flight details later.

All info subject to government approval and schedule changes.

The 2nd daily to Jakarta - EK358/359 will now start much earlier than originally planned. It will build up in phases - here's the sequence.

Effective 2 May 2009, it will operate 3x weekly on Mon, Wed, Sat.

Effective 6 December 2009, a 4th weekly will be added on Sun.

Effective 1 March 2010, the service will become Daily.

Selected aircraft swap of the month. During the month of April the A343 and B77W are being swapped around on JNB and ATH routes.

Currently confirmed until April 17, and will likely continue for the rest of the month:

EK105/106 DXB-ATH-DXB operated by A340-300 on a daily basis.

EK765/766 DXB-JNB-DXB operated by B777-300ER (deep reclining in J) on a daily basis.

More musical chairs on the 2009/10 operating plan. The following aircraft changes take place effective 1 June 2009.

EK037/038 DXB-BHX-DXB upgraded from A330-200 (2-class) to B777-300ER (3-class)

EK050/051 DXB-MUC-DXB downgraded from A340-300 (3-class) to A330-200 (3-class)

EK721/722 DXB-NBO-DXB downgraded from A330-200 (3-class) to A330-200 (2-class)

EK781/782 DXB-LOS-DXB downgraded from B777-300ER (3-class) to A340-300 (3-class)

Effectively this is an aircraft swap to better align capacity with loads. Basically the B77W from LOS will be moved to BHX, and the A332 (2-class) from BHX will be moved NBO, and NBO's A332 (3-class) will be moved to MUC, and MUC's A343 (3-class) will be moved to LOS.

Note, the 3-class B77W to BHX will be sold as 2-class, with the First class SkyCruiser seats sold as J in addition to the normal J class cabin. Anyone travelling BHX in J should bag those first two rows as you get flat bed seats.

Effective 25 October EK787/788 to/from ABJ will drop to 4x weekly (Tue, Thu, Fri, Sun) from Daily.

The planned aircraft upgrade effective 1 Dec to A343 from B77W will go through.

EK787/788 will continue to operate to ACC on a daily basis.
